Castelvecchio celebrates his first stakeswinner

Dual Group 1 winner Castelvecchio is now on the board as a Group-siring stallion. (PHOTO: Joan Faras)

Six months ago El Castello gave early notice of his talent when he was runner-up to subsequent Champion 2YO Broadsiding in the Fernhill Mile LR.

Now, after a scintillating victory in the $500,000 ATC Gloaming S. 1800m G3, he is Castelvecchio’s first stakeswinner, and trainer Anthony Cummings is confident there is more success ahead of him.

“All of these runs have been like a training gallop towards the Spring Champion. He’ll be better over 2000 metres and even better again in Melbourne.” Cummings won the the 2012 Victoria Derby G1 with El Castello’s relative Fiveandahalfstar.

The stable sent out a second winner by Castelvecchio on Saturday, the filly Motoscafo who scored in good style over 1200m at Kembla Grange. She is nominated for the Thousand Guineas G1 on 16 November.

Castelvecchio is now 4th on the current Australian Second Season Sires’ table with 6 winners, another stakes performer (Comanche Miss) and $604,000 prizemoney.

Jockey Josh Parr, who also rode Castelvecchio in 3 of his four victories, including the Champagne S. G1, echoed Anthony Cummings’ comments on El Castello’s performance.

“He travelled really nicely in a beautiful position and showed a turn of foot that was obviously unparalleled. I’m very pleased with him. He’s just taken the natural progression each time I’ve sat on him…He’s got the perfect temperament for the 2000 metres and then possibly the Derby trip.”

Bred by Brendan Lindsay of Cambridge Stud, El Castello is the second foal of Word Games (by Fastnet Rock), a city-winning half-sister to dual Group 1 winner Fiveandahalfstar. This is the distinguished Princess Patine family of Group 1 winners Captivate, Cross Swords, Culminate, Eileen Dubh, Gallic, Jon Snow, Master O’Reilly, Savaria, Soliloquy & Solveig.

El Castello was offered by Cambridge Stud at the 2023 Magic Millions Gold Coast Sale, where he was purchased by his trainer for $220,000.
